<p>A lot of people complained (me included) when they saw that Assassin&#8217;s Creed II was nominated for a Game Of The Year Award (among others) at the VGA&#8217;s as it has only been out a few weeks.</p>
<p>But anyone who has played Assassin&#8217;s Creed II will be able to tell you why it was nominated &#8211; it is indeed <em>that</em> good.</p>
<p>The first Assassin&#8217;s Creed was a good game with some nice ideas and lovely graphics but it suffered from repetitive missions and the fact you had to synchronise viewpoints to access the next section.</p>
<p>No such problems with the sequel as Ubisoft have taken on the feedback from the critics and fans. For example you&#8217;re a lot more free to approach missions as you want to and the viewpoints are now optional &#8211; they reveal more helpful locations on the map but they aren&#8217;t obligatory.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assinscreedii-1.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2417" title="AssassinsCreedII 1"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assinscreedii-1.jpg" alt="" width="459" height="290" /></a></p>
<p>The story picks up with Desmond Miles after the conclusion of the first game as he escapes with Lucy Stillman from the Abstergo Industries building and finds himself in a safe house with a new Animus, delving into another set of ancestral memories.</p>
<p>This time you&#8217;ll be playing as Ezio Auditore da Firenze in Italy in the 1400&#8217;s. This is a glorious setting as you move between Tuscany, Florence, Venice and more. The difference in areas is apparent and they have gone to a lot of trouble to make each feel individual.</p>
<p>As well as the main plot missions there are a wealth of side missions and collectibles &#8211; the ones that hooked me were the Assassin&#8217;s Seals. These are objects hidden in tombs and churches that are basically climbing and exploring sections &#8211; once you get all six you can unlock Altair&#8217;s armour that is locked away in your Villa.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2418" title="Assassins Creed II 4"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-ii-goty-awards1.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="316" /></p>
<p>You can do races, collect feathers, find glynphs, beat people up and take on side assassinations among other things.</p>
<p>This freedom of choice means you never feel railroaded into anything and delivers a wonderful gaming experience.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s not without it&#8217;s problems though.</p>
<p>On occasions the combat and climbing mechanics are clunky and don&#8217;t respond in the way you need it to &#8211; annoying if you&#8217;ve almost climbed a huge building only to inadvertently dive down into the water instead of jumping up further.</p>
<p>My main complaint was the codex pages &#8211; collectables you could find and convert into extra health, weapon upgrades etc. But they are also integral to the game and you&#8217;ll need all 30 to do the final mission.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assinscreedii-2.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2419" title="AssassinsCreedII 2"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assinscreedii-2.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="339" /></a></p>
<p>If I&#8217;d known they were that important I&#8217;d have picked them up as I went along &#8211; instead it meant before the last mission I had to go and find the last 14! Totally broke the pacing of the game/story.</p>
<p>But they are small problems within a hugely enjoyable gaming experience. Assassin&#8217;s Creed II is the game the first wanted to be &#8211; finally the ideas have been realised and I can&#8217;t wait for the next instalment.</p>

<p>Written in the early 14th Century, Dante&#8217;s Inferno tells the story of a man (Dante) who finds himself lost in a wood on Good Friday of 1300 with seemingly no way out. Then a spirit called Virgil comes and explains he can help him but the two of them will have to travel through the nine circles of hell: <em>Limbo, Lust, Gluttony, Avarice (hoarding of material possessions), Wrath &#38; Sloth, Heresy, Violence, Fraud and Treason</em>.</p>
<p>Virgil acts as the man&#8217;s guide on behalf of Beatrice &#8211; a beautiful goddess who wants an audience with the man.</p>
<p>Beatrice is believed to be Dante&#8217;s real life childhood sweet heart, who lived next door to him but died aged only 24 years old. <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_sad.gif' alt=':sad:'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p>And so begins their descent through hell, meeting lots of well known historical figures and also some of the people from Dante&#8217;s life (presumably those who really annoyed him <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':smile:' class='wp-smiley' /> )</p>

<p>As someone who quite enjoyed the first Assassin&#8217;s Creed game, despite it&#8217;s somewhat repetitive nature, I was really looking forward to stepping back into Altair&#8217;s shoes.</p>
<p>Assassin&#8217;s Creed: Bloodlines picks up after the end of the previous game, with Altair travelling to Cyprus to seek out and destroy the last of the Templars.</p>
<p>Having been playing Assassin&#8217;s Creed 2 alongside it the button set up felt natural but it might seem a little confusing at first, with three sets of controls attributed to the face buttons depending on what else you&#8217;re pressing.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-psp-1.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2385" title="Assassins Creed PSP 1"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-psp-1.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="270" /></a></p>
<p>So on their own they perform low level feats such as blending into a crowd etc, with the left shoulder button held they control the camera angle and with the right shoulder button held they perform high risk feats such as climbing/assassinations etc. It sounds more complicated than it is! <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_wink.gif' alt=':wink:'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p>Unfortunately, as is the case for the two PS3 games (though less so for Assassin&#8217;s Creed 2, which is a lot more intuitive), this means you&#8217;ll often be trying to flee by climbing and the game won&#8217;t recognize your button press in time. It doesn&#8217;t happen too much thankfully and when the system works it is thrilling.</p>
<p>Obviously being a handheld title the AI doesn&#8217;t challenge too much and it was a little easy to just blend into a crowd after murdering someone but once the alert is raised they will persue you fairly relentlessly &#8211; which is great.</p>
<p>They come in numbers as well, although you&#8217;ll probably not have more than 4 or 5 around you at one time. Believe me that is more than enough &#8211; on a few occasions I found myself ducking out of fight situations and making a run for it <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_lol.gif' alt=':lol:'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-psp-2.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2387" title="Assassins Creed PSP 2"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-psp-2.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="232" /></a></p>
<p>The storyline was fairly interesting and concerned the Templar archive that Altair was trying to track down.</p>
<p>On the downside the audio was pretty poor, not only in terms of voice acting but also the spoken word parts skipped and jumped in places (switch the subtitles on!).</p>
<p>The gameplay itself is a touch repetitive and overall the experience reminded me much of the first game rather than the improved sequel.</p>
<p>The graphics are superb and Altair has some great assassination animations. There was no slowdown or anything like that, even with numerous enemies and civilians on screen. It&#8217;s nice to see people pushing the PSP.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-psp-3.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2388" title="Assassins Creed PSP 3"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/assassins-creed-psp-3.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="258" /></a></p>
<p>One thing that is cool is the connectivity between the PSP game and Assassin&#8217;s Creed 2 on the PS3. Depending on your progress you can unlock new things in both &#8211; to be honest it&#8217;s better going from the PSP to PS3 as you get 6 new weapons (sweet <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_cool.gif' alt=':cool:' class='wp-smiley' /> ) whereas on the PSP you get a few bits, like being able to block with the hidden blade etc. Would love to see more games do this.</p>
<p>Overall then Assassin&#8217;s Creed: Bloodlines reminds me a lot of the Syphon Filter PSP games &#8211; good fun to play but a touch repetitive and without major challenge. Definitely worth a play though.</p>
<p>This gets an 8 rather than a 7 for the very cool connectivity idea.</p>

<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><p><a href="http://bookpage.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/vision-in-white.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-2866 alignright" title="vision in white" src="http://bookpage.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/vision-in-white.jpg?w=208" alt="" width="92" height="134" /></a>Via <em>Entertainment Weekly</em>’s <a href="http://shelf-life.ew.com/2009/12/08/nora-roberts-to-release-a-downloadable-game-based-on-her-work/">Shelf Life blog</a>, we learned yesterday that Queen of Romance Nora Roberts is expanding into the computer game market. <a href="http://www.bookpage.com/reviews.php?id=10001242"><strong>Vision in White</strong></a>, her novel about four friends who run a wedding-planning business, will turn interactive as gamers play “nuptial-themed mini-games” and perform “hidden-object tasks” in its computer game equivalent.</p>
<div id="attachment_2867" class="wp-caption alignleft" style="width: 149px"><a href="http://bookpage.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/nora-roberts.jpg"><img class="size-full wp-image-2867 " title="Nora Roberts" src="http://bookpage.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/nora-roberts.jpg" alt="" width="139" height="205"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">Nora Roberts</p></div>
<p>Agatha Christie, James Patterson and Dan Brown have already inspired games, and Roberts – herself a gamer – is pleased to join their ranks. “I think it’s great that there are so many kinds of media to play with,” said Roberts in a press release. “And to have a story translated into a game like this, it’s tremendous fun for me.”</p>

<p>I&#8217;ve been fortunate on the beta front recently &#8211; as well as <a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/2009/11/26/battlefield-bad-company-2-beta-impressions-ps3/" target="_blank">Battlefield Bad Company 2</a> I also managed to get myself on the list for Sony&#8217;s upcoming FPS <strong>MAG</strong>.</p>
<p>The beta, which closed today ahead of the game&#8217;s January 2010 release, featured only two modes (Domination and Sabotage &#8211; which are your standard &#8216;Capture &#38; Hold&#8217; and &#8216;Search And Destroy&#8217;) but they were varied enough to give you a flavour of the gameplay you can expect.</p>
<p>As I&#8217;ve said before I&#8217;m not a huge fan of &#8216;twitch shooters&#8217; &#8211; FPS&#8217;s where the slightest movement of the stick spins the camera round fast &#8211; as I find them both unrealistic and fairly unsatisfying (yes <a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/2009/11/19/call-of-duty-modern-warfare-2-review-ps3/" target="_blank">Modern Warfare 2</a> I&#8217;m looking at you) &#8211; and MAG veers dangerously close but has just enough weight in the controls to save it.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/mag-sver.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2332" title="MAG SVER"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/mag-sver.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="309" /></a></p>
<p>The great thing about MAG is that you&#8217;re constantly reminded that your match is just one of many going on but that every small victory helps your faction in the overall war.</p>
<p>I plumped for the S.V.E.R faction (which is a bunch of ragtag rebel fighters <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_cool.gif' alt=':cool:' class='wp-smiley' />  ) as, being perfectly honest I&#8217;m sick of playing of US soldiers (who make up the VALOR faction). Obviously nothing against the US or anything just that it makes a change to be offered a different side to play for. The last remaining faction are RAVEN, Tactical Elites who are super polished fighters.</p>
<p>Each faction has different weaponry and, I believe, a few different special weapons (airstrikes etc) to call in.</p>
<p>The gameplay itself is really good and some of the more frantic Domination matches were superb &#8211; just to give you a sense of scale, where games normally have you defending one or two points on the map MAG has you defending/attacking <strong>SIX!</strong> <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_surprised.gif' alt=':eek:'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/mag-1.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2333" title="MAG 1"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/12/mag-1.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="290" /></a></p>
<p>With up to 256 players online in the same game they have had to up the ante and it seems to have been done really well.</p>
<p>With regard to the way it plays and controls, as I said above it&#8217;s just the right side of twitch and I found it pretty enjoyable to play. If you didn&#8217;t know where you were going it was a pain in the ass at times as more experienced folk picked you off from a distance but being honest that happens in most games of this type anyway when you start playing.</p>
<p>Overall I&#8217;d say it&#8217;s not quite as promising as Battlefield Bad Company 2 but for me it&#8217;s step up from Modern Warfare 2 as it feels a lot more involved and you are part of a bigger picture.</p>

<p>Electronic Arts was a powerhouse of great gaming during my formative gaming years. Classics such as <strong>Road Rash</strong>, <strong>Desert Strike</strong>, <strong>FIFA</strong>, the <strong>Mutant League</strong> series, <strong>PGA Tour Golf </strong>and <strong>James Pond</strong> to name a few, were always innovative and a delight to play.</p>
<p>But somehow over time EA became the &#8216;bad guy&#8217; &#8211; the heartless corporation who were happy to churn out yearly updates of average games, often with little or no improvement.</p>
<p>Suddenly we had <strong>Burnout, Need For Speed, Harry Potter, SSX, the Def Jam fighting games</strong> <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_mad.gif' alt=':mad:' class='wp-smiley' />  and a host of annual sports updates. The difference being that these games (possibly excluding a few Burnout titles) were just not that great.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/mutant-league-football.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2187" title="Mutant League Football"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/mutant-league-football.jpg" alt="" width="455" height="357" /></a></p>
<p>They started buying smaller, rival studios and created big rifts in the industry by often closing the studios down and taking their best talent.</p>
<p>And then all of a sudden things changed a few years ago &#8211; as well as the usual updates they announced two games which turned people&#8217;s impressions of EA on their head: <strong>Dead Space</strong> and <strong>Mirror&#8217;s Edge</strong>.</p>
<p>Two games which were highly polished, innovative, produced to an extremely high level&#8230; and were original ideas. Not a sequel or prequal &#8211; or even a film tie in. Just cleverly made great games.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/mirrorsedge.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2188" title="MirrorsEdge"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/mirrorsedge.jpg" alt="" width="459" height="269" /></a></p>
<p>Now I&#8217;m the first to admit that maybe Mirror&#8217;s Edge had it&#8217;s faults but that isn&#8217;t the issue here &#8211; what I&#8217;m talking about is EA&#8217;s willingness to take a shot at launching a new brand, based on something no-one had tried before.</p>
<p><strong>Brutal Legend</strong> is another fine example &#8211; while the game appears to have tanked at retail, which is a shame, EA backed it all the way with marketing and promo. Not all of their new ideas come off so to speak.</p>
<p>The other shift was that the year updates, sporting especially, got good again. The <strong>Fight Night</strong> series was a serious return to form, culminating in Round 4&#8217;s superb simulation of the sport. Likewise <strong>FIFA</strong> &#8211; which has now overtaken long standing champion <strong>PES</strong> as the best football game around.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2192" title="Brutal Legend EA"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/brutal-legend-ea.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="287" /></p>
<p>With <strong>Rock Band</strong> they are looking to take on Activision (the new &#8216;bad guys&#8217; apparently) and <strong>Guitar Hero</strong>, a battle which will rage for years to come.</p>
<p>The standard of games forthcoming as well looks really positive with <strong>Army Of Two: 40th Day, Dante&#8217;s Inferno, Mass Effect 2</strong> (not for us PS3 folks&#8230; yet <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_wink.gif' alt=':wink:' class='wp-smiley' /> ) and <strong>Battlefield Bad Company 2</strong> (the Beta of which is truly stunning) all arriving in the first quarter of 2010!</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/dantes-inferno3.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2190" title="Dante's Inferno"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/dantes-inferno3.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="327" /></a></p>
<p>When I think back to 5 or 6 years ago it seems insane that EA of all people would be pushing the envelope and delivering top quality, fresh and innovative titles &#8211; long may it continue!</p>

<p>For the first time in a long while I have not been sucked into the hype for a big triple A game.</p>
<p>I just wasn&#8217;t excited about Modern Warfare at all &#8211; a mixture of not getting on with the first title and a general disappointment from the multiplayer footage I&#8217;d seen.</p>
<p>Upon firing up the single player mode I was struck by how good the graphics were and after a quick run through the training camp I was on my way.</p>
<p>The campaign mode sees you take on the role of several characters and while the story is full of big set pieces, the lack of depth in any of the characters you control leads to a sense of confusion at times.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modern-warfare-2-1.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2177" title="Modern Warfare 2 1"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modern-warfare-2-1.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="273" /></a></p>
<p>This is also one of the games biggest weaknesses &#8211; without any sort of attachment to any of the characters it was difficult to care about what was going on as I worked my way through set piece after set piece.</p>
<p>The set pieces themselves were great when they worked but on the whole were another weakness in my opinion.</p>
<p>Take the snow mobile ride. Now I know someone who did it in one flowing attempt and thought it was amazing. It took me 3 or 4 goes to nail it &#8211; on one occasion failing right on the last jump as I wasn&#8217;t going quick enough &#8211; and was just a disappointing pain in the ass. <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_sad.gif' alt=':sad:'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p>I just feel sections like that should be very hard to mess up, not knocking into one tree kills you (as realistic as that is).</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modern-warfare-2-2.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2178" title="Modern Warfare 2 2"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modern-warfare-2-2.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="299" /></a></p>
<p>Overall the single player is a bit of an enjoyable mess, with a story that is all over the place.</p>
<p>But no-one is going to be buying Modern Warfare 2 for the campaign mode&#8230; it&#8217;s all about the multiplayer.</p>
<p>And it&#8217;s a pretty good experience.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s been patched 4 times in the opening two weeks after release which I think may be a record &#8211; and it certainly struggles at times.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modern-warfare-2-3.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2179" title="Modern Warfare 2 3"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modern-warfare-2-3.jpg" alt="" width="460" height="306" /></a></p>
<p>I&#8217;ve been kicked off because &#8216;the server is full&#8217;, disconnected from lobbies, been unable to party up, got stuck in doorways, had the cpu move for me when I was trying to stay still and had general connection issues.</p>
<p>Having said all that the actual gameplay is polished, and while it took a while to get used to the speed of moving (having been used to the slower Killzone 2), Modern Warfare 2 is fantastic fun online.</p>
<p>They have incorporated some features from other games and improved their own stuff from the previous installment.</p>
<p>The best thing for me are the Deathstreaks, where instead of being rewarded for killing opponents you get a bonus for dying. Very helpful if you&#8217;re having a bad round or just starting out. <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':smile:'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p>Modern Warfare 2 is a vast multiplayer experience, with a ton of unlocks and perks to get over time. It&#8217;s a rich and deep set of abilities and weapons, which will keep you busy for a while to come.</p>
<p><a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modernwarfare2.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2180" title="ModernWarfare2"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/modernwarfare2.jpg" alt="" width="459" height="272" /></a></p>
<p>As an overall package though Modern Warfare 2 is a lopsided beast.</p>
<p>The single player lacks any depth and would be no great loss to skip and the multiplayer, while fun and engaging, is extremely glitchy and suffers from connection problems.</p>
<p>Better than I thought then but not quite the second coming everyone was raving about.</p>

<p>Infinity Ward&#8217;s decision not to release a demo before launch for <strong>Call Of Duty: Modern Warfare 2</strong> struck me as odd &#8211; I&#8217;m usually very suspicious of a game that doesn&#8217;t have a demo.</p>
<p>Got something to hide? Just not quite as good as everyone thinks? (Hi <a href="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/2009/07/13/prototype-review-ps3/" target="_blank">Prototype</a> <img src='http://s.wordpress.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':smile:' class='wp-smiley' /> )</p>
<p>For sure Modern Warfare 2 probably doesn&#8217;t need a demo pre-release of the game with the hype it&#8217;s had but in most cases a lack of demo is often a sign of a weak game.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2156" title="PES 2010 Demo"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/pes-2010-demo.jpg" alt="PES 2010 Demo" width="460" height="276" /><em>PES 2010 Demo: Unfinished</em></p>
<p>And sometimes even putting out a demo just makes things worse, especially as the demo is usually months old and sometimes not finished properly (hang your head in shame <strong>PES 2010</strong>).</p>
<p>But there is also a flip side to this argument. There have also been a few games where the demo just hasn&#8217;t done the game justice.</p>
<p>Take for example <strong>Batman: Arkham Asylum</strong> &#8211; one of my favourite games this year. The demo wasn&#8217;t great.</p>
<p>The makers were obviously trying to show off both the combat and stealth sections but for some reason taken out of the context of the game it didn&#8217;t really work.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2157" title="Batman2"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/batman2.jpg" alt="Batman2" width="460" height="336" /><em>Batman Arkham Asylum: Too good to fit into a demo?</em></p>
<p>I think some people were put off by that demo but hopefully the universally high review scores will have made them think again.</p>
<p>My good friend Hollow Snake always says he thought the <strong>Infamous</strong> demo had it right &#8211; give you all the powers and let you run riot.</p>
<p>Show what you could have if you get the game and stick with it. I can certainly see the logic but I&#8217;ve often wondered if that would overwhelm more casual gamers, who might be looking to get into a new title?</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-2158" title="inFAMOUS" src="http://greghorrorshow.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/infamous.jpg" alt="inFAMOUS" width="460" height="297" /><em>inFAMOUS: The way a demo should be done?</em></p>
<p>I know of at least one person that couldn&#8217;t be bothered to even finish the demo as there were too many control instructions.</p>
<p>I often prefer games that give you the first level (or some of it) to play through, like <strong>Killzone 2</strong> or <strong>Brutal Legend</strong>. (Having said that I think Brutal Legend&#8217;s demo is pretty misleading &#8211; making you think it&#8217;s a hack &#8216;n&#8217; slash rather than an RTS game)</p>
<p>Either way I&#8217;m glad that we are now given a chance to easily access demos and I am firmly in favour of them. To be honest they have been one of the best things about the PSN for me.</p>
